TRAPR is a new R-based pipeline for RNA sequencing (RNA-Seq) data analysis. It integrates statistical analysis and visualization, simplifying gene expression studies.

Area of Science:

  • Bioinformatics
  • Computational Biology
  • Genomics

Background:

  • RNA sequencing (RNA-Seq) is crucial for gene expression measurement.
  • Existing Bioconductor tools for RNA-Seq analysis are fragmented and lack integration.
  • Current tools lack comprehensive visualization for data integrity checks.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To introduce TRAPR, an integrated R-based pipeline for RNA-Seq data analysis.
  • To provide a unified framework for statistical analysis and visualization of RNA-Seq data.
  • To enable researchers to build customized RNA-Seq analysis workflows.

Main Methods:

  • Development of an R-based software package named TRAPR.
  • Implementation of functions for data management, quality filtering, normalization, and transformation.
